
Slow-braised beef brisket is the kind of centerpiece dish that makes a whole table go quiet in the best possible way. This version builds deep, complex flavor through a combination of coconut aminos, pure maple syrup, apple cider vinegar, and bone broth ā a braising liquid that caramelizes around the meat as it slowly becomes fork-tender in the oven. The brisket gets a fragrant rub of turmeric, ground ginger, and sea salt before being seared in coconut oil until it develops a gorgeous, golden crust that locks in all that richness. Sliced yellow onion, smashed garlic, fresh ginger, and chunky carrots round out the pot, turning the braising liquid into something you'll want to spoon over everything. Because every ingredient here is straightforwardly beef- and vegetable-based, there's no need to scrutinize labels for hidden pork-derived additives or sneaky flavor enhancers ā what you see is exactly what goes in. The low-and-slow method at 325°F does the heavy lifting, so by the time you pull it from the oven, the meat practically melts when pressed with a fork. Finished with a scatter of fresh parsley and those tender braised carrots, this is the kind of meal that feels genuinely special without requiring any complicated technique.

Preheat the oven to 325°F (165°C). In a small bowl, stir together the salt, turmeric, and ground ginger. Pat the brisket completely dry with paper towels, then rub the spice mixture evenly over all sides.
Heat the coconut oil in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at until shimmering. Add the brisket fat-side down and sear, undisturbed, for 4ā5 minutes until deep golden brown and releasing easily from the pot. Flip and sear the other side for 3ā4 minutes until equally browned. Transfer the brisket to a plate.
